Churros with Hot Chocolate
What does it include?
Ingredients
- 500ml water
- 125 g butter
- 5 ml sal
- 5 ml vanilla extract
- 250 g all-purpose flour
- 3 eggs
- Oil for frying
- 240 ml sugar
- 5 ml cinnamon
- For the chocolate sauce: 200 g semisweet chocolate, 250 ml milk, 1/960 ml sugar, 5 ml vanilla extract
How to prepare it step by step?
Preparation
- Heat the water, butter, salt, and vanilla in a saucepan over medium heat until the butter melts.
- Remove from the heat and add the flour all at once, mixing quickly until a soft dough forms. Return to the heat and cook, stirring constantly, until the dough comes away from the sides of the pan.
- Let the dough cool slightly, then add the eggs one at a time, mixing well after each addition until the dough is smooth and glossy.
- Heat the oil in a deep frying pan to 180°C (350°F).
- Pour the dough into a pastry bag with a curly nozzle and form strips of churros, frying them until golden and crispy.
- Drain on absorbent paper.
- Mix sugar and cinnamon in a deep plate and immediately coat the churros.
- For the chocolate sauce, heat the milk with the sugar and vanilla in a saucepan over medium heat until the sugar dissolves.
- Remove from heat and add the chocolate, stirring until completely melted and smooth.
- Serve the churros hot with the hot chocolate sauce.
Full description
Savor the authentic taste of classic Spanish churros, paired with a velvety hot chocolate sauce. These churros boast a delightful crunch on the outside and a soft, tender interior, creating a symphony of textures. Each bite, dipped in rich, aromatic chocolate, promises a sensory journey. Perfectly balanced with a hint of cinnamon sugar, these treats are a must-try for any chocolate lover. Enjoy the warmth and indulgence of this timeless combination.
